A Comparative Analysis of EBITDA Growth: UPS vs. Avery Dennison

In the ever-evolving landscape of global logistics and manufacturing, United Parcel Service, Inc. (UPS) and Avery Dennison Corporation stand as titans in their respective fields. From 2014 to 2023, UPS consistently outperformed Avery Dennison in terms of EBITDA, showcasing a robust financial trajectory. Notably, UPS's EBITDA peaked in 2022, reaching approximately 17 billion, marking a 47% increase from 2014. In contrast, Avery Dennison's EBITDA growth was more modest, with a peak in 2022 at around 1.37 billion, reflecting a 118% increase from its 2014 figures. This disparity highlights UPS's dominant market position and operational efficiency. However, Avery Dennison's steady growth underscores its resilience and strategic adaptability in the face of industry challenges.
